What is B2B cold calling?
B2B cold calling is the process sales teams use to reach out to potential business customers who have not yet expressed interest, with the goal of starting conversations and creating qualified opportunities. Unlike B2C sales, B2B cold calling targets decision-makers inside companies, which requires specific techniques, patience, and strategy.

4. Qualify before pitching
Not every prospect is ready to buy, and not every call should lead to a pitch. Lead qualification ensures reps spend time with prospects who are most likely to convert.
At Konsyg, SDRs qualify using the BANT framework: Budget, Authority, Need, Timeline. This ensures the lead has decision-making power, a pressing business need, and a realistic buying window.
By filtering early, SDRs book higher-quality meetings, increase conversion rates, and improve ROI on outbound campaigns.

9. Optimise calling times and cadences
Just like SEO determines where your site ranks, timing and cadence determine how effective your calls are.
Konsyg SDRs track connect rates by region, industry, and role, ensuring dials happen during “money hours.” Testing call cadences (e.g., 3 calls + 2 emails across 10 days) helps optimise sequences for maximum conversions.
By refining timing and consistency, you increase call efficiency and pipeline growth without burning through lists.

2. Cognism
Cognism is a sales intelligence platform that empowers SDRs with verified global data, phone numbers, and intent signals. It ensures reps spend less time researching and more time connecting with decision-makers.
Key features:
- Diamond Data® (phone-verified mobile numbers)
- Intent data powered by Bombora
- GDPR and CCPA-compliant database
- Seamless CRM integrations
- Global coverage

3. LinkedIn Sales Navigator
Sales Navigator enables advanced prospecting through LinkedIn’s professional network. SDRs can identify decision-makers, build lead lists, and personalise cold outreach.
When combined with structured cold calling cadences, Sales Navigator becomes a powerful targeting layer for B2B appointment setting.
4. Dialpad
Dialpad equips teams with an AI-powered business phone system that supports cold calling at scale. With real-time transcription, call analytics, and integration with CRMs, it helps sales teams optimise every conversation.
This tool is especially valuable for monitoring SDR performance and refining call scripts to improve connect-to-meeting ratios.
